Outils pour utilisateurs

Outils du site


all:bibles:linux:serveur:mysql

Différences

Ci-dessous, les différences entre deux révisions de la page.

Lien vers cette vue comparative

Les deux révisions précédentesRévision précédente
Prochaine révision
Révision précédente
all:bibles:linux:serveur:mysql [2026/01/19 10:50] – [donner tous les droits sur une bdd] omeylhocall:bibles:linux:serveur:mysql [2026/01/19 10:55] (Version actuelle) omeylhoc
Ligne 4: Ligne 4:
  
 ===== Installation/Démarrage ===== ===== Installation/Démarrage =====
- 
  
 ==== Installation ==== ==== Installation ====
Ligne 74: Ligne 73:
 ==== changement de mot de passe root ==== ==== changement de mot de passe root ====
  
-<code bash>+<code sql>
 mysql> SET password FOR "root"@"localhost" = password('Nouveau_mot_de_passe');  mysql> SET password FOR "root"@"localhost" = password('Nouveau_mot_de_passe'); 
 </code> </code>
Ligne 95: Ligne 94:
   * vérification sous mysql   * vérification sous mysql
  
-<code bash>+<code sql>
 mysql> SHOW VARIABLES LIKE 'char%';  mysql> SHOW VARIABLES LIKE 'char%'; 
 </code> </code>
  
 ---- ----
- 
-[[all:bibles:linux:serveur:mysql|Haut de page]] 
  
 ===== Désinstallation ===== ===== Désinstallation =====
Ligne 127: Ligne 124:
  
 ---- ----
- 
-[[all:bibles:linux:serveur:mysql|Haut de page]] 
  
 ===== Administration ===== ===== Administration =====
Ligne 134: Ligne 129:
 ==== lister utilisateurs et host ==== ==== lister utilisateurs et host ====
  
-<code bash>+<code sql>
 mysql> select user,host from mysql.user;  mysql> select user,host from mysql.user; 
 </code> </code>
Ligne 140: Ligne 135:
 ==== créer utilisateur ==== ==== créer utilisateur ====
  
-<code bash>+<code sql>
 mysql> create user "nom_utilisateur"@"localhost";  mysql> create user "nom_utilisateur"@"localhost"; 
 </code> </code>
Ligne 146: Ligne 141:
 ==== définir mot de passe ==== ==== définir mot de passe ====
  
-<code bash>+<code sql>
 mysql> set password for "nom_utilisateur"@"localhost" = password('mot_de_passe');  mysql> set password for "nom_utilisateur"@"localhost" = password('mot_de_passe'); 
 </code> </code>
Ligne 152: Ligne 147:
 ==== supprimer un utilisateur ==== ==== supprimer un utilisateur ====
  
-<code bash>+<code sql>
 mysql> drop user "nom_utilisateur"@"localhost";  mysql> drop user "nom_utilisateur"@"localhost"; 
 </code> </code>
Ligne 158: Ligne 153:
 ==== créer une bdd ==== ==== créer une bdd ====
  
-<code mysql>+<code sql>
 mysql> create database <nombdd> character set = 'utf8'; mysql> create database <nombdd> character set = 'utf8';
 </code> </code>
Ligne 164: Ligne 159:
 ==== donner tous les droits sur une bdd ==== ==== donner tous les droits sur une bdd ====
  
-<code bash>+<code sql>
 mysql> grant all on nom_base.* to "nom_utilisateur"@"localhost"; mysql> grant all on nom_base.* to "nom_utilisateur"@"localhost";
 </code> </code>
Ligne 170: Ligne 165:
 ==== supprimer les droits ==== ==== supprimer les droits ====
  
-<code bash>+<code sql>
 mysql> revoke all privileges on nom_base.* from "nom_utilisateur"@"localhost";  mysql> revoke all privileges on nom_base.* from "nom_utilisateur"@"localhost"; 
 </code> </code>
Ligne 176: Ligne 171:
 ==== lister les droits ==== ==== lister les droits ====
  
-<code bash>+<code sql>
 mysql> show grants for "nom_utilisateur"@"localhost";  mysql> show grants for "nom_utilisateur"@"localhost"; 
 </code> </code>
Ligne 194: Ligne 189:
 ==== supprimer une base de données ==== ==== supprimer une base de données ====
  
-<code bash>+<code sql>
 mysql> drop database <database_name>; mysql> drop database <database_name>;
 </code> </code>
  
 ---- ----
- 
-[[all:bibles:linux:serveur:mysql|Haut de page]] 
  
 ===== Utilisation ===== ===== Utilisation =====
  
-<code>+<code sql>
 show databases; show databases;
 connect <database_name>; connect <database_name>;
Ligne 213: Ligne 206:
  
 ---- ----
- 
-[[all:bibles:linux:serveur:mysql|Haut de page]] 
  
 ===== MariaDB ===== ===== MariaDB =====
Ligne 223: Ligne 214:
  
 ---- ----
- 
-[[all:bibles:linux:serveur:mysql|Haut de page]] 
  
 ===== Debug ===== ===== Debug =====
Ligne 267: Ligne 256:
 SHOW VARIABLES LIKE '%log%'; SHOW VARIABLES LIKE '%log%';
 </code> </code>
- 
- 
  
 <note important>S'assurer que les répertoires de logs existent et sont accessibles en écriture par l'utilisateur MySQL</note> <note important>S'assurer que les répertoires de logs existent et sont accessibles en écriture par l'utilisateur MySQL</note>
Ligne 278: Ligne 265:
 </code> </code>
  
----- 
- 
-[[all:bibles:linux:serveur:mysql|Haut de page]] 
all/bibles/linux/serveur/mysql.1768816259.txt.gz · Dernière modification : de omeylhoc